The United States Army is part of the Department of Defense and has been active since 1775. The Army has 561,984 Active personnel and 567,299 Reserve and National Guard personnel. The United States Army’s official motto is “This We’ll Defend.” The Army has undergone over 20 wars, including the most recent War in Afghanistan and Iraq War.
The Army has specific qualification for their candidates, including US citizenship, 17-35 years old, healthy, moral, and at least a high school or equivalent education.
The Army members operate under the leadership of Secretary Hon. John M. McHugh, Gen. Raymond T. Odierno, Gen. Peter W. Chiarelli, and SMA Raymond F. Chandler.
